Ribonucleotide reductase rnr also known as ribonucleotide diphosphate reductase rndp is an enzyme that catalyzes the formation of deoxyribonucleotides from ribonucleotides. Nucleotides are composed of a nitrogen containing base adenine guanine cytosine uracil or thymine a five carbon sugar ribose or deoxyribose and one or more phosphate groups.
